发明名称 中断控制系统及方法
摘要 一种中断控制系统及方法,系应用于一具有中断服务系统之电子设备,其中,该系统系由设置单元、储存单元以及处理单元所构成,该方法系首先,储存中断控制程式于该储存单元中;接着,显示一设置介面,俾供设置特定之中断控制指令,并储存该特定之中断控制指令至该储存单元中;以及最后,执行储存于该储存单元之中断控制程式,以控制该中断服务系统依据该特定之中断控制指令执行相应之中断处理作业。藉由本发明可依据使用者之实际需求,对中断处理作业进行相应的控制管理,俾使系统管理中断作业更具灵活性,以提升其应用价值。
申请公布号 TWI283829 申请公布日期 2007.07.11
申请号 TW094121809 申请日期 2005.06.29
申请人 英业达股份有限公司 发明人 卢盈志;赵文谦
分类号 G06F9/48(2006.01) 主分类号 G06F9/48(2006.01)
代理机构 代理人 陈昭诚 台北市中正区博爱路35号9楼
主权项 1.一种中断控制系统,系应用于具有中断服务系统 之电子设备,用以控制该中断服务系统执行相应之 中断控制作业,该中断控制系统至少包括: 设置单元,系提供设置介面,俾供设置特定之中断 控制指令; 储存单元,系具有第一资料储存区及第二资料储存 区,且于该第一资料储存区中储存有中断控制程式 ;以及 中央处理单元,系与该设置单元及储存单元电性连 接,其用以将设置于此该设置单元中之特定的中断 控制指令储存至该第二资料储存区中,并执行储存 于该第一资料储存区之中断控制程式,以控制该中 断服务系统依据该特定之中断控制指令执行相应 的中断处理作业。 2.如申请专利范围第1项之中断控制系统,其中,该 中断控制系统系作为一应用程式运行于该电子设 备之作业系统中。 3.如申请专利范围第1项之中断控制系统,其中,该 中断服务系统系藉由一系统管理中断处理程式(SMI Handler)处理执行中断作业。 4.如申请专利范围第3项之中断控制系统,其中,该 系统管理中断处理程式系嵌设于该电子装置之基 本输入输出系统(Basic Input Output System)程式中。 5.如申请专利范围第3项之中断控制系统,其中,该 特定之中断控制指令系有包括系统管理中断处理 程式之禁能、致能、周期性禁能以及周期性致能 。 6.如申请专利范围第1项之中断控制系统,复包括编 辑单元,其用以提供编辑用户管理中断处理程式( User Handler)。 7.如申请专利范围第6项之中断控制系统,其中,该 用户管理中断处理程式系储存于该第一资料储存 区。 8.如申请专利范围第6项之中断控制系统,其中,该 特定之中断控制指令复包括以该用户管理中断处 理程式置换该系统管理中断处理程式、将该用户 管理中断处理程式添加至该系统管理中断处理程 式中、自该系统管理中断处理程式中删除该用户 管理中断处理程式。 9.如申请专利范围第8项之中断控制系统,其中,该 用户管理中断处理程式置换该系统管理中断处理 程式系指对该系统管理中断处理程式进行禁能,而 执行该用户管理中断处理程式。 10.如申请专利范围第8项之中断控制系统,其中,该 将该用户管理中断处理程式添加至该系统管理中 断处理程式中系指于执行系统管理中断处理程式 前,优先执行该用户管理中断处理程式。 11.如申请专利范围第1项之中断控制系统,其中,该 第一资料储存区系为记忆体(Memory)。 12.如申请专利范围第1项之中断控制系统,其中,该 储存于第二资料储存区中之中断控制指令系于关 闭该电子设备电源后自动清除。 13.如申请专利范围第12项之中断控制系统,其中,该 第二资料储存区系为随机存取记忆体(RAM)。 14.如申请专利范围第1项之中断控制系统,其中,该 中央处理单元系透过该中断控制程式对该电子设 备之输入输出(I/O)端口执行写入操作以触发一中 断讯号。 15.如申请专利范围第1项之中断控制系统,其中,于 该中断控制程式控制该中断服务系统执行相应中 断处理作业时,该中断服务系统会产生用以显示其 当前执行状况之回应码于该中断控制程式。 16.如申请专利范围第1项之中断控制系统,其中,该 中央处理单元系于该中断服务系统接收执行一中 断讯号时,即启动该中断控制程式。 17.如申请专利范围第1项之中断控制系统,其中,该 中央处理单元系于该中断服务系统执行一符合该 中断控制指令所定义之规则的作业时,即启动该中 断控制程式。 18.如申请专利范围第1项之中断控制系统,其中,该 电子设备系为个人电脑、笔记型电脑、个人数位 助理以及掌上电脑其中之一者。 19.一种中断控制方法,系应用于具有申请专利范围 第1项所述之中断控制系统的电子设备中,用以控 制该中断服务系统执行相应之中断控制作业,该中 断控制方法至少包括: (1)储存中断控制程式于第一资料储存区中; (2)显示一设置介面,俾供设置特定之中断控制指令 ,并储存该特定之中断控制指令至第二资料储存区 中;以及 (3)执行储存于该第一资料储存区之中断控制程式, 以控制该中断服务系统依据该特定之中断控制指 令执行相应之中断处理作业。 20.如申请专利范围第19项之中断控制方法,其中,该 中断控制系统系作为一应用程式运行于该电子设 备之作业系统中。 21.如申请专利范围第19项之中断控制方法,其中,该 中断服务系统系藉由一系统管理中断处理程式(SMI Handler)处理执行中断作业。 22.如申请专利范围第21项之中断控制方法,其中,该 系统管理中断处理程式系嵌设于该电子装置之基 本输入输出系统(Basic Input Output System)程式中。 23.如申请专利范围第19项之中断控制方法,其中,该 特定之中断控制指令系有包括系统管理中断处理 程式之禁能、致能、周期性禁能以及周期性致能 。 24.如申请专利范围第19项之中断控制方法,复包括 编辑一用户管理中断处理程式(User Handler),并将该 用户管理中断处理程式储存于该第二资料储存区 。 25.如申请专利范围第24项之中断控制方法,其中,该 特定之中断控制指令复包括以该用户管理中断处 理程式置换该系统管理中断处理程式、将该用户 管理中断处理程式添加至该系统管理中断处理程 式中、自该系统管理中断处理程式中删除该用户 管理中断处理程式。 26.如申请专利范围第26项之中断控制方法,其中,该 用户管理中断处理程式置换该系统管理中断处理 程式系指对该系统管理中断处理程式进行禁能,而 执行该用户管理中断处理程式。 27.如申请专利范围第26项之中断控制方法,其中,该 将该用户管理中断处理程式添加至该系统管理中 断处理程式中系指于执行系统管理中断处理程式 前,优先执行该用户管理中断处理程式。 28.如申请专利范围第19项之中断控制方法,其中,该 第一资料储存区系为记忆体(Memory) 29.如申请专利范围第19项之中断控制方法,其中,该 储存于第二资料储存区中之中断控制指令系于关 闭该电子设备后自动清除。 30.如申请专利范围第29项之中断控制方法,其中,该 第二资料储存区系为随机存取记忆体(RAM)。 31.如申请专利范围第19项之中断控制方法,其中,该 中央处理单元系透过该中断控制程式对该电子设 备之输入输出(I/O)端口执行写入操作以触发一中 断讯号。 32.如申请专利范围第19项之中断控制方法,其中,于 该中断控制程式控制该中断服务系统执行相应中 断处理作业时,该中断服务系统会产生用以显示其 当前执行状况之回应码于该中断控制程式。 33.如申请专利范围第19项之中断控制方法,其中,该 中央处理单元系于该中断服务系统接收执行一中 断讯号时,即启动该中断控制程式。 34.如申请专利范围第19项之中断控制方法,其中,该 中央处理单元系于该中断服务系统执行一符合该 中断控制指令所定义之规则的作业时,即启动该中 断控制程式。 35.如申请专利范围第19项之中断控制方法,其中,该 电子设备系为个人电脑、笔记型电脑、个人数位 助理以及掌上电脑其中之一者。 图式简单说明: 第1图系为本发明之中断控制系统所需之基本架构 方块示意图;以及 第2图系为本发明之中断控制方法之处理流程示意 图。
地址 台北市士林区后港街66号